Exemple #1
0
        public CatProveedorAlmacenModels ObtenerDetalleProveedorAlmacenxID(CatProveedorAlmacenModels datos)
        {
            try
            {
                object[]      parametros = { datos.IDProveedorAlmacen };
                SqlDataReader dr         = null;
                dr = SqlHelper.ExecuteReader(datos.Conexion, "spCSLDB_Catalogo_get_CatProveedorAlmacenXID", parametros);
                while (dr.Read())
                {
                    datos.IDProveedorAlmacen = !dr.IsDBNull(dr.GetOrdinal("IDProveedor")) ? dr.GetString(dr.GetOrdinal("IDProveedor")) : string.Empty;// Convert.ToInt32(dr["ID_UnidadMedida"].ToString());
                    datos.IDSucursal         = !dr.IsDBNull(dr.GetOrdinal("IDSucursal")) ? dr.GetString(dr.GetOrdinal("IDSucursal")) : string.Empty;
                    datos.RazonSocial        = !dr.IsDBNull(dr.GetOrdinal("NombreSucursal")) ? dr.GetString(dr.GetOrdinal("NombreSucursal")) : string.Empty;
                    datos.RFC             = !dr.IsDBNull(dr.GetOrdinal("Rfc")) ? dr.GetString(dr.GetOrdinal("Rfc")) : string.Empty;
                    datos.TelefonoCelular = !dr.IsDBNull(dr.GetOrdinal("TelefonoCelular")) ? dr.GetString(dr.GetOrdinal("TelefonoCelular")) : string.Empty;
                    datos.TelefonoCasa    = !dr.IsDBNull(dr.GetOrdinal("TelefonoCasa")) ? dr.GetString(dr.GetOrdinal("TelefonoCasa")) : string.Empty;
                    datos.Correo          = !dr.IsDBNull(dr.GetOrdinal("Correo")) ? dr.GetString(dr.GetOrdinal("Correo")) : string.Empty;
                    datos.FechaIngreso    = !dr.IsDBNull(dr.GetOrdinal("FechaIngreso")) ? dr.GetDateTime(dr.GetOrdinal("FechaIngreso")) : DateTime.Today;
                    datos.Direccion       = !dr.IsDBNull(dr.GetOrdinal("Direccion")) ? dr.GetString(dr.GetOrdinal("Direccion")) : string.Empty;
                    datos.Observaciones   = !dr.IsDBNull(dr.GetOrdinal("Obsevaciones")) ? dr.GetString(dr.GetOrdinal("Obsevaciones")) : string.Empty;
                }
                dr.Close();
                return(datos);
            }

            catch (Exception ex)
            {
                throw ex;
            }
        }
Exemple #2
0
 public CatProveedorAlmacenModels AbcCatProveedorAlmacen(CatProveedorAlmacenModels datos)
 {
     try
     {
         object[] parametros = { datos.Opcion,
                                 datos.IDProveedorAlmacen ?? string.Empty,
                                 datos.IDSucursal ?? string.Empty,
                                 datos.RazonSocial ?? string.Empty,
                                 datos.RFC ?? string.Empty,
                                 datos.TelefonoCelular ?? string.Empty,
                                 datos.TelefonoCasa ?? string.Empty,
                                 datos.Correo ?? string.Empty,
                                 datos.FechaIngreso != null ? datos.FechaIngreso : DateTime.Today,
                                 datos.Direccion ?? string.Empty,
                                 datos.Observaciones ?? string.Empty,
                                 datos.TodaSucursale,
                                 datos.Usuario ?? string.Empty };
         object   aux = SqlHelper.ExecuteScalar(datos.Conexion, "spCSLDB_Catalogo_ac_CatProveedorAlmacen", parametros);
         datos.IDProveedorAlmacen = aux.ToString();
         if (!string.IsNullOrEmpty(datos.IDProveedorAlmacen))
         {
             datos.Completado = true;
         }
         else
         {
             datos.Completado = false;
         }
         return(datos);
     }
     catch (Exception ex)
     {
         throw ex;
     }
 }
Exemple #3
0
 public CatProveedorAlmacenModels EliminarProveedorAlmacen(CatProveedorAlmacenModels datos)
 {
     try
     {
         object[] parametros =
         {
             datos.IDProveedorAlmacen, datos.Usuario
         };
         object aux = SqlHelper.ExecuteScalar(datos.Conexion, "spCSLDB_Catalogo_del_CatProveedorAlmacen", parametros);
         datos.IDProveedorAlmacen = aux.ToString();
         if (!string.IsNullOrEmpty(datos.IDProveedorAlmacen))
         {
             datos.Completado = true;
         }
         else
         {
             datos.Completado = false;
         }
         return(datos);
     }
     catch (Exception ex)
     {
         throw ex;
     }
 }
Exemple #4
0
        public List <CatProveedorAlmacenModels> ObtenerListaProveedorAlmacen(string Conexion)
        {
            try
            {
                List <CatProveedorAlmacenModels> Lista = new List <CatProveedorAlmacenModels>();
                CatProveedorAlmacenModels        Item;
                SqlDataReader dr = null;
                dr = SqlHelper.ExecuteReader(Conexion, "spCSLDB_Catalogo_get_CatProveedorAlmacen");
                while (dr.Read())
                {
                    Item = new CatProveedorAlmacenModels();
                    Item.IDProveedorAlmacen = !dr.IsDBNull(dr.GetOrdinal("IDProveedor")) ? dr.GetString(dr.GetOrdinal("IDProveedor")) : string.Empty;
                    Item.RazonSocial        = !dr.IsDBNull(dr.GetOrdinal("RazonSocial")) ? dr.GetString(dr.GetOrdinal("RazonSocial")) : string.Empty;
                    Item.Direccion          = !dr.IsDBNull(dr.GetOrdinal("Direccion")) ? dr.GetString(dr.GetOrdinal("Direccion")) : string.Empty;
                    Item.RFC            = !dr.IsDBNull(dr.GetOrdinal("Rfc")) ? dr.GetString(dr.GetOrdinal("Rfc")) : string.Empty;
                    Item.Correo         = !dr.IsDBNull(dr.GetOrdinal("Correo")) ? dr.GetString(dr.GetOrdinal("Correo")) : string.Empty;
                    Item.NombreSucursal = !dr.IsDBNull(dr.GetOrdinal("NombreSucursal")) ? dr.GetString(dr.GetOrdinal("NombreSucursal")) : string.Empty;
                    Lista.Add(Item);
                }
                dr.Close();
                return(Lista);
            }

            catch (Exception ex)
            {
                throw ex;
            }
        }